Present Perfect and Past Simple

Додано: 26 червня 2020
Предмет: Англійська мова, 11 клас
Тест виконано: 108 разів
27 запитань
Запитання 1

I haven't been to Italy ____ July 2005.

варіанти відповідей



Запитання 2

Jim has studied ___ three hours. Now he is tired.

варіанти відповідей



Запитання 3

My friend has been ill___ a long time.

варіанти відповідей



Запитання 4

I haven't seen him____Eastern

варіанти відповідей



Запитання 5

He hasn't done any work_____ a month.

варіанти відповідей



Запитання 6

We have ___ met an American actor.

варіанти відповідей



Запитання 7

Has your husband___sold the house?

варіанти відповідей



Запитання 8

I haven’t started my new job ___.

варіанти відповідей



Запитання 9

I have ___ seen this horror film before

варіанти відповідей



Запитання 10

The cat has ___ eaten the fish

варіанти відповідей



Запитання 11

Last night I___ (lose) my keys - I had to call my husband to let me in.

варіанти відповідей




have lost

Запитання 12

I'm sorry, John isn't here now. He ___ (go) to the shops.

варіанти відповідей


have gone

has gone


Запитання 13

Yesterday, I _____ (see) all of my friends. It was great.

варіанти відповідей



has seen

was seeing

Запитання 14

The baby's face is really dirty. What ___(he/eat)?

варіанти відповідей

has he eat

has he eaten

was he eating

did he eat

Запитання 15

I ____(read) your book since Monday. It's very interesting, but I'm only on chapter 2.

варіанти відповідей

have read

have readed


am reading

Запитання 16

John ____ (never/understand) the present perfect.

варіанти відповідей

has never understand

hasn`t never understand

has never understood

have never understood

Запитання 17

 At the weekend, they__ (play) football, then they ___(go) to a restaurant.

варіанти відповідей

have played / went

have played / have gone

played / went

played / gone

Запитання 18

I____(not/have) any coffee today - I feel very sleepy!

варіанти відповідей

haven`t have

haven`t had

don`t have

not have

Запитання 19

 When the boss ___ (walk) into the room we ___ (know) someone was going to get fired.

варіанти відповідей

walked / knew

has walked / knew

was walking / went

walked / has known

Запитання 20

A:Hello my dear! How are the things?

B:Hi Mum! I just want to say I (arrive) safely and everything is fine. Love you.

варіанти відповідей

has arrived

have arrived


have arriven

Запитання 21

Choose the right sentence

варіанти відповідей

I have just hurt my leg.

I has never hurt my leg.

I have ever hurted my leg.

He have just hurt my leg.

Запитання 22

Choose the right sentence

варіанти відповідей

She has already passed her exam. Congratulations!

She have already passed her exam. Congratulations!

She haves already passed her exam. Congratulations!

She has already pass her exam. Congratulations!

Запитання 23

Choose the right sentence

варіанти відповідей

- Have they washed their hair? - Yes, they have.

- Has they washed their hair? - Yes, they have.

- Have they washed their hair? - Yes, they washed.

- Have they washed their hair? - Yes, they did.

Запитання 24

Choose the right sentence

варіанти відповідей

Jim and Jane have decided to get married.

Jim and Jane have decide to get married.

Jim and Jane hases decided to get married.

Jim and Jane decided to get married.

Запитання 25

Choose the right sentence

варіанти відповідей

Kate has studed two foreign languages.

Kate hasn`t studied two foreign languages.

Kate has studyed two foreign languages.

Kate studied two foreign languages.

Запитання 26

I was very late. When I arrived, the conference _____.

варіанти відповідей

was already starting


have already started

Запитання 27

When they arrived at the police station, he said that he _____ anything wrong last Sunday.

варіанти відповідей

didn't do

wasn't doing

haven't done

Створюйте онлайн-тести
для контролю знань і залучення учнів
до активної роботи у класі та вдома

Створити тест